Pilot Salary in Grand Prairie, TX

From the listings we have, the average salary for Pilots in Grand Prairie is $122,000 per year or $58.8 per hour, although pay can vary widely based on type of employer and experience level.

Job listings typically fall within a salary range between $95,800 per year and $149,000 per year, reflecting differences in hours flown, certifications, and aircraft types.

Lowest wage for Pilots in Grand PrairieAverage wage for Pilots in Grand PrairieHighest wage for Pilots in Grand Prairie
$95,800 per year$122,000 per year or $58.8 per hour$149,000 per year

Corporate and jet Pilots working for major companies or charter services generally earn higher salaries.

What To Expect as a Pilot in Grand Prairie

Pilot jobs in Grand Prairie typically involve:

  • Operating aircraft safely according to regulations
  • Conducting pre-flight inspections and planning
  • Communicating with air traffic control
  • Handling navigation and flight monitoring systems

Pilots must maintain up-to-date certifications and adhere strictly to safety protocols.

The role requires strong decision-making skills, the ability to work irregular hours, and excellent situational awareness.

Employers value Pilots with solid flight experience and professionalism, though some entry-level opportunities may also exist.
